Identify Factors Influencing Backup Duration

In an era where cyber threats loom large, knowing how long does it take to backup your computer can mean the difference between operational resilience and catastrophic data loss. Several factors significantly influence this duration, each playing a crucial role in ensuring data security and operational resilience:

  1. Volume: Have you ever considered how the sheer volume of data you need to secure can impact your backup duration? In sectors like healthcare and finance, where volumes are substantial, it is particularly significant to know how long does it take to backup your computer, as larger collections naturally necessitate more time to back up. Indeed, 35% of businesses that encountered data disruptions last year were unable to retrieve their lost information due to insufficient copies, emphasizing the dangers linked to inadequate data preservation processes.
  2. Connection Speed: Next, let’s consider how your connection speed plays a crucial role in this process. For example, how long does it take to backup your computer over a slow USB connection can significantly increase the duration required, potentially leading to operational delays.
  3. Hardware Performance: Think about it: if your hardware is outdated, it could slow down your data transfers and increase the risk of loss during recovery. The specifications of your computer, including CPU speed and disk read/write rates, directly influence how long does it take to backup your computer. Older hardware may struggle with large data transfers, increasing the risk of data loss during crucial recovery scenarios.
  4. Storage Method: Did you know that the type of backup strategy you choose can drastically affect how long does it take to backup your computer? Various data preservation strategies - full, incremental, or differential - have differing time demands. Full copies take the longest, while incremental versions are generally quicker after the initial creation, making them a preferred choice for many organizations aiming for efficiency. As Brad Warbiany notes, the focus has shifted from backup to data resilience, emphasizing the need for robust strategies that ensure quick recovery.
  5. Document Types: The nature of the documents being backed up can also influence speed. Backing up numerous small files often takes longer than backing up a few large files due to the overhead associated with processing each file.

Calculate Your Estimated Backup Time

In an era where cyber threats loom large, understanding your data backup process is not just important - it's critical for your organization's survival. Let’s break down how to calculate your estimated backup time effectively:

  1. Evaluate Your File Size: Ascertain the total volume of the information you need to secure, which can usually be located in your file explorer or recovery software. Remember, with 3.3 billion stolen credentials currently in circulation, understanding your information size is crucial for effective protection.
  2. Evaluate Your Connection Speed: Check your internet or network speed using online speed tests for an accurate measurement. This step is crucial as ransomware attacks are increasing by 53% annually, making a dependable connection necessary for timely data preservation.
  3. Use the Formula: A basic formula to estimate backup time is:
    Backup Time (in hours) = Total Data Size (in GB) / Transfer Speed (in GB/hour)
    For instance, if you have 100 GB of data and your transfer speed is 10 GB/hour, your estimated backup time would be 10 hours.
  4. Adjust for Other Factors: Consider additional elements such as hardware performance and document types. If your data comprises numerous small documents, add an additional 20-30% to your estimated duration to account for processing overhead. Regular testing of data copies is essential to ensure they are functioning correctly and that files are properly stored.
  5. Plan Accordingly: Once you have your estimated duration, schedule your data saves during off-peak hours to minimize disruption to your workflow. Troubleshoot Common Backup Issues

In the ever-evolving landscape of cybersecurity, healthcare organizations face unique challenges that can jeopardize their data integrity. Even with careful planning, you may encounter obstacles during the data recovery process. Here are some common problems and effective troubleshooting strategies:

  1. Slow Data Transfer Rates: Are you experiencing delays in your data transfer? It could be a sign of underlying issues. Check your connection speed and ensure that no other bandwidth-heavy applications are running simultaneously. For better stability, consider using a wired connection instead of Wi-Fi.
  2. Recovery Failures: If your recovery process fails, it’s crucial to check for error messages in your recovery software. Common causes include inadequate storage space, corrupted data, or software conflicts. Ensure that your storage location has sufficient space and that your documents are not locked or currently in use.
  3. Inconsistent Data Recovery Times: Are your recovery times varying significantly? This inconsistency may stem from the type of files being saved. To maintain consistency, consider scheduling complete data copies during off-peak hours and utilizing incremental saves during regular hours.
  4. Software Issues: Ensure that your recovery software is up to date. Outdated software can lead to compatibility problems and bugs that may hinder performance during data recovery.
  5. Hardware Problems: If you suspect hardware issues, run diagnostics on your hard drives and check for any signs of failure. Regular maintenance can help prevent hardware-related data issues.
